Correction on Article

Posted on 20 October 2018 by The Tactical Hermit

 

This is my first time doing one of these, so bear with me!

Yes, even I make mistakes folks! 🙂

In Yesterdays article titled Self-Defense Cautionary Tales: Is a $16 Hatchet Worth It?

I stated that the thief was not ARMED at the time of the shooting.

“It would have been different if the guy had the hatchet it in his hand and was threatening the guy, but that was not the case.”

Well, as a good friend pointed out to me, YES, in fact the thief WAS ARMED with said axe at the time of the shooting, (You can see the axe in his right hand when he is going out the door.)

This changes the entire incident folks, at least according to self-defense law.

Marry this with the store owner feeling “in fear for his life” and it is an open and shut case.

Entering into the argument of “Well the thief was not swinging the axe or acting threatening with it” is asinine.

We cannot determine INTENT from a 50 second video clip!

It’s a shame anytime a person has to kill another person to protect themselves, but we have to understand that the store owner had a split second to make a decision we have a lifetime to analyze.
